## Authentication

The Farecrest pricing experiment API requires a bearer token on every request. As a contractor, you'll use the shared sandbox credential rather than a personal one — it scopes you to the experiment endpoints only. Pass it in the Authorization header. Rotation happens monthly; check the wiki if calls start failing. Current sandbox token is below.

portal login ticket: eyJhbGciOiJIUzI1NiIsInR5cCI6IkpXVCJ9.eyJzdWIiOiI8fpAIDIn0.2HWsKY39

# Sweepline Environments

Quick tour for the security folks reviewing our data-retention sweeper. Sweepline runs in three environments: dev (synthetic data only), staging (scrubbed copies from the Harwick cluster), and prod. The sweeper wakes hourly, deletes records past their retention window, and writes a tamper-evident audit log per run. Dev and staging use aggressive 7-day windows so we catch bugs fast; prod honors the real policy schedule. Each environment's sweeper behavior is driven entirely by the values below.

service settings:
[quenath]
host = quenath.zemvarcorp.corp
user = quenath_svc
database = quenath_prod

Quarterly Planning Note – FY Headcount

To: Sales Leads
From: J. Ostrand, Planning

Next year's plan adds nine roles: six account executives (Dravenport and Millhaven), two solutions engineers, one ops analyst. Backfills frozen until Q2. Draft territory maps circulate next week; raise objections before then, not after. Rationale and targets are set out in the confidential note below.

board note of kaduf-yagag: Sorvanax Foods is in early talks to buy Holiusix Systems for about $409.8 million. The Quenwyn launch date is May 26, and nothing goes to the press before then. Legal wants the Gormirax Foods term sheet withdrawn before October 24.